Central Authority

The National Security Council – Strategic Trade Management Committee (NSC-STMCom) is the central authority on any and all matters relating to strategic trade management. It is composed of the following members: (1) the Executive Secretary, as Chairperson; (1) the Executive Secretary, as Chairperson; (2) the Secretary of Trade and Industry, as Vice Chairperson; and (3) the Secretary of Foreign Affairs; (4) the Secretary of Justice; (5) the Secretary of National Defense; (6) the Secretary of the Interior and Local Government; (7) the Secretary of Finance; (8) the Secretary of Transportation; (9) the National Security Advisor; (10) the Secretary of Environment and Natural Resources; (11) the Secretary of Science and Technology; (12) the Secretary of Agriculture; (13) the Secretary of Health; and (14) the Secretary of Information and Communications Technology.
